The housing landscape in Western Australia is at a critical juncture. With alarming statistics revealing a 27.5% decline in new construction loans, a rental vacancy rate of merely 0.7%, and a continuous decrease in the total number of social housing stock under Labor's administration, the plight of Western Australians in search of affordable housing has reached unprecedented levels.
